Further criticism for transfer taxi provider
A local woman has caused a stir on social media, after filming a patient transfer journey in Liverpool she's branded 'unacceptable'.
Hayley Daugherty was traveling with her mother, who suffers from a joint condition, between the city's airport and a nearby hospital appointment last week.
ComCab, the company now contracted by the Manx government to carry out the transfers, has attracted some criticism since it took over from specialist providers Bridgewater following a tender process.
Ms Daugherty says the standard of care was 'awful', and Bridgewater staff and vehicles were much better attuned to patients' varying needs.
She's contacted the Department of Health and Social Care, which has said it's keen to hear feedback on the service.
